Transaction 34dcce17faaae8d81093e5b34e906d41c853663e5f18963410d31bc20f5abfea

10 Input
2 Outputs
  • 34dcce17faaae8d81093e5b34e906d41c853663e5f18963410d31bc20f5abfea:0
  • value  30000000
    address  3KJYDFXtFZDW9sN5JvRVjgAi8g2W3us52x
  • 34dcce17faaae8d81093e5b34e906d41c853663e5f18963410d31bc20f5abfea:1
  • value  3155353
    address  37AbQ4L82jEtTrafWG5bgcCJxJmwUcYhX6